Softball Recap: Hilltop Cadets vs. Edon Bombers
Hilltop can now show off six landslide victories after their most recent matchup on Tuesday. They never let the Edon Bombers onto the board and left with a 12-0 win. The victory was nothing new for Hilltop as they're now sitting on four straight.
Kelsy Connolly was a major factor no matter where she played. She looked comfortable on the mound, not allowing a single earned run while striking out 12 over five innings pitched. Connolly has been consistent recently: she hasn't tossed less than six strikeouts in five consecutive pitching appearances. Connolly was also solid in the batter's box, scoring two runs while going 2-for-3.
In other batting news, Hilltop let Halle Jones and Joscelyn Layman loose on the outfield. Jones scored a run and stole two bases while going 2-for-3, while Layman scored a run while going 3-for-3. Jones has been hot recently, having posted two or more stolen bases the last four times she's played. Another player making a difference was Isabella Ackley, who scored a run while going 2-for-3.
On Edon's side, they sa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Natalie Wofford, who went 1-for-2 with two stolen bases.
Hilltop is on a roll lately: they've won five of their last six contests, which provided a nice bump to their 6-3 record this season. As for Edon, they haven't won a game yet this season and fell to 0-6.
Coincidentally, both teams will both be playing Montpelier the next time they take the field. Hilltop will head out to face Montpelier at 4:00 p.m. on Wednesday, while Edon will head out to face them at 5:00 p.m. on Thursday.
